Output 436dd8f3f656352088f99084b8ac5d5af891e788b9a579dbf000b4a16da960b5:0

value
660000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d9ddf2fee01901635fa321fec4a3c7b3298060 OP_EQUAL
address
39WxMWiPjMBAiq8T8G8GvUNEdEEzVABGhR
transaction
436dd8f3f656352088f99084b8ac5d5af891e788b9a579dbf000b4a16da960b5
spent
true